Output 646e233bb90468cd69de3c88f61c2c4208d47216f9fb882058a80e5f1bf02768:1

value
5271530
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7fbc6b5e71b57b701861ddfc4f850588cebdf6b OP_EQUAL
address
MTbB8PfwDuxL16A3SLTmqCN3m33V7LQe6n
transaction
646e233bb90468cd69de3c88f61c2c4208d47216f9fb882058a80e5f1bf02768
spent
true